Regulation: Complaint intake and mediation structure
Protecting the rights of investors and consumers of financial services in Europe.
Reasons for referral
- Account blocking or inability to withdraw funds;
- Pressure from brokers;
- Suspicion of manipulation or misleading marketing;
- Loss of assets due to the actions of third parties;
- Denial of verification without explanation.




Stages of review
- Online application (via EBFA website);
- Confirmation of identity and provision of documents;
- Conducting an independent ‘investigation’;
- Recommendations for action;
If necessary, filing a complaint with supranational structures
(including EFRAUD and OLAF - official reference for legitimacy).
EBFA acts as an independent mediator and is not legally responsible for the actions of third parties. Decisions are advisory in nature.
